Flexcomm and USB OTG — interface flexibility

The Flexcomm peripheral lets you repurpose serial pins as I2C, SPI, or UART without changing the PCB — useful when a last-minute BOM swap requires a different protocol. USB OTG adds host/device capability, so the same MCU can act as a USB flash-drive reader for firmware updates or as a peripheral to a PC for data logging.
